Explanation

The P239A code is triggered when the Engine Control Module (ECM) detects an intermittent or erratic signal from the diesel intake air flow B position sensor.

Technical description

The diesel intake air flow B position sensor monitors the amount of air entering the engine. If the sensor's signal is inconsistent or erratic, the ECM may not be able to properly control the air-fuel mixture, leading to performance issues.

Symptoms

• Check Engine Light is on

• Poor engine performance

• Decreased fuel efficiency

Common Causes

• Faulty intake air flow B position sensor

• Wiring issues such as damaged wires or poor connections

• ECM malfunction

Diagnosis steps

• Use an OBD-II scanner to confirm the code

• Inspect the wiring and connectors for damage

• Test the intake air flow B position sensor for proper operation

Repair procedures

• Replace the intake air flow B position sensor if faulty

• Repair or replace damaged wiring or connectors

• Reprogram or replace the ECM if necessary
